Abstract
Angular distributions of neutrons from the 2H(γ, n)reaction were measured for six photon energies between 6-9 MeV. The results were fitted to a Legendre polynomials expansion up to and including P3(cos θ). The coefficients A1/A0 and A3/A0 were found to deviate considerably from theoretical calculations using different nucleon-nucleon potentials. These results indicate that the E1-E2 interference is considerably larger than expected.
